
US: Expropriation of Land Without Compensation Would Send South Africa Down Wrong Path
August 24, 2018, 12:46 AM
The U.S. State Department says that U.S. President Donald Trump and Secretary of State Mike Pompeo have discussed South Africa's land reform. A spokesperson said Thursday that the president asked Pompeo to investigate reports that the South African government is expropriating land owned by white farmers without compensation.
